Executive Summary

Credit Acceptance Corporation (CACC) recently released its official the previous quarter earnings results, marking the latest public performance update for the U.S.-based auto finance provider focused on subprime vehicle lending. The company reported a quarterly earnings per share (EPS) of $8.92, alongside total quarterly revenue of $2.29 billion (or $2,287,900,000 in exact reported terms). Management Commentary

During the accompanying earnings call held following the release of the previous quarter results, CACC leadership discussed core operational trends that shaped the quarter’s performance. Management highlighted that adjustments to underwriting standards implemented earlier in the period may have contributed to stable loss rates within the company’s loan portfolio, aligning closely with internal pre-set risk targets. Leadership also noted that demand for used vehicle financing remained steady over the quarter, offset partially by some softness in consumer repayment behavior amid broader macroeconomic conditions. Management additionally noted investments in digital loan processing tools rolled out over the quarter could help reduce operational costs over time, though the full impact of those investments has not yet been quantified. Forward Guidance

In its the previous quarter earnings materials, Credit Acceptance Corporation did not issue specific numerical forward guidance, consistent with its typical public reporting practices. Instead, leadership noted that the company would continue to closely monitor key macroeconomic variables including interest rate movements, used vehicle price volatility, and broader consumer credit health to adjust its operational strategy as needed in upcoming periods. Management also indicated that it may adjust underwriting criteria and loan origination volumes to balance growth and risk, depending on evolving market conditions. Analysts covering CACC have noted that the lack of specific guidance leaves room for potential adjustments to market expectations as more real-time sector data becomes available in the coming weeks. Market Reaction

In the trading sessions immediately following the release of CACC’s the previous quarter earnings, the stock traded with near-average volume, per available public market data. Price action was moderate in the days after the release, with no extreme volatility observed in initial trading activity. Analysts covering the auto finance sector have noted that CACC’s results offer useful insights into the health of the subprime auto lending segment, which has been a focus of market participants amid ongoing concerns about consumer credit stress. Some analysts have pointed to the company’s consistent risk management track record as a potential buffer against broader sector headwinds, while others have flagged potential risks from upcoming regulatory proposals related to auto lending that could impact operational costs for firms in the space over the near term. Market participants are expected to continue monitoring CACC’s operational updates for signals about broader trends in consumer credit and used vehicle markets in coming months.
